S1 On dc-powered units, side power board
S1A

Installed

For 1.25 to 12 Vdc excitation at 120 mA

S1B

Installed

For 24 Vdc excitation at 35 mA

S3, S4, S5 On dc-powered unit, main board
S3A

Installed

To store data and setup parameters in nonvolatile memory

S3B

Omit

See note in previous section 6.4.1

S3C

Installed

Unlocks lockout menu (L1 through L4)

S3D

Installed

Unlocks Front pushbuttons

S4A

Installed

Along with the S1 jumper to program the excitation output.
Adjust excitation with R34 surface mount pot from 1.25 to 12
volts, with an output current up to 120 mA.

S4A

Removed

For 24 Vdc excitation. (S4A located in storage position).

S5A

Installed

To enable the RESET front panel pushbutton.

S5A

Removed

To secure against unauthorized meter reset.


7.0 SIGNAL AND POWER INPUT CONNECTIONS

7.1 Introduction

The following describes how to connect your sensors to your meter with and without sensor excitation and how to
connect the AC power to your meter. Prior to wiring the sensor to the meter, check with a multimeter that a proper
excitation exists.
